William Will Davies is a fictional character on the long running Channel 4 United Kingdom British television soap opera Hollyoaks . He was played by actor Barny Clevely between 2000 2004, with a brief return from April 8 11, 2005. Character history Will was quite laid back but responsible and supportive to his children Ben Davies Hollyoaks Ben and Abby Davies Abby . Will began early on dating Sue Morgan and the relationship seemed to be going reasonably well until Sue decided to return to her husband Andy. Will was devastated as he was deeply in love with her, and on several occasions he tried to persuaded Sue away from Andy, but it did not change her mind. With the help of Ben, Will decided to move on. In Hollyoaks, murders began happening with the targets being young blonde girls and Will was under pressure by the residents of the village after he failed to discover any further leads. In came List of Hollyoaks characters 2003 Dale Jackson DCI Dale Jackson , who took over the case and Will got major designs on his colleague, when he asked her to move in with the Davies. Abby was certainly pleased and hoped that Will could find happiness with Dale, but Ben disliked the idea. One night, Will was left shocked and devastated when he caught Dale and Ben in bed together. An ashamed Ben tried to apologise however, Will insisted that it really never bothered him and made it clear to Ben that he was free to do anything he wanted. Luckham played the White Guardian in the long running science fiction television series Doctor Who . He appeared in The Ribos Operation , the first serial in The Key to Time season, and Enlightenment Doctor Who Enlightenment . He appeared in an Who Killed Cock Robin? Randall and Hopkirk Deceased episode of Randall and Hopkirk Deceased 1969 , as the villain. Luckham was a familiar face as a character actor in the 1970s he appeared the 1978 TV series based on The Famous Five characters The Famous Five books by Enid Blyton , as the evil psychic Edward Drexel in the 1979 supernatural thriller series The Omega Factor , and as the equitable Chair of the school board of Bamfylde in the 1980 Andrew Davies adaptation of To Serve Them All My Days . He also portrayed Archbishop Thomas Cranmer in the film adaptation of A Man for All Seasons 1966 film A Man for All Seasons 1966 and the long suffering Father O Hara in Some Mothers Do Ave Em . Perhaps his most significant role was as the paternalist puppet prime minister in 1971 s dialectical dystopian drama The Guardians TV series The Guardians in which Britain is plunged into a tacit Fascist state policed by the ubiquitous Guardians or G s as they are referred to with disturbing familiarity. Cyril Camus is the President of the family owned company Camus Cognac which is based in the town of Cognac in Charente , France . Cyril is the fifth generation of Camus Cognac having succeeded Jean Babtiste Camus, Edmond & Gaston Camus, Michel Camus and Jean Paul Camus. Cyril studied Business at Babson College in Wellesley, Massachusetts , USA before joining Camus to work as the company s Trade Relations Director in Beijing . In 1998 Cyril returned to France and became Camus Marketing Director. In 2004 Cyril became President of the company succeeding his father Jean Paul Camus. Cyril Thomas is a professional boxer from France . He was born on October 30, 1976, in Saint Quentin, Aisne, France, where he also lives. The orthodox stance featherweight fighter has a professional record of 44 fights 36 wins 10 KO , 4 losses and 4 draws. He is a former France and European featherweight champion. Mount Cyril is an ice covered mountain, convert 1,190 m high, standing convert 2 nmi km 0 south of Celebration Pass in the Commonwealth Range .
